They should re-name it the West Side Parkway.

The construction hoists in the pics that JohnFlint1985 posted (east side) will extend all the way to the roof, eventually. They are also the high speed, high cap hoists.

The ones on the west side should only extend to the 44th floor, above that internal hoists take over.
